Tools

Models, pipelines & AI that keep your systems modern

Whether you are on legacy tech or established standards, Codebots modernises your environment with models, reusable templates, and cloud-native automation — reducing technical debt and enabling continuous improvement.

LEarn more about Codebots LEarn more about Codebots

Models + AI

Codebots combines model-driven engineering with AI assistance to help you modernise continuously — pairing smart automation with structured modelling so your organisation can evolve with confidence.

Cover artwork for the Codebots white paper
Download the white paper Download the white paper

Modernisation

1. Discover

Capture business needs as visual models — user journeys, interfaces, data structures, logic, and behaviours — to align teams and reduce ambiguity.

2. Modernise

Generate most requirements from models using reusable templates tailored to your preferred stack. Move faster with consistency and quality.

3. Optimise

Provision application & infrastructure as code to your cloud. Keep improving with the same models that drive delivery.

High-level model and platform relationship Models align requirements to delivery and power automation across the toolchain.

Bots

Reusable platform, model, and pipeline resources that speed up delivery and enforce good governance. We use a set of starter bots on customer projects:

  • CommonBot — shared foundations such as terminology, teams, and roles.
  • ISOBot — resources for management standards across security, quality, and environments.
  • PRINCE2Bot — project management and governance assets.
  • ApplicationBot — builds your application from models and templates.
Bot Marketplace showing reusable resources

The Bot Marketplace approach streamlines governance, delivery, and standardisation across teams.

Platform

The architectural blueprint for your software and models. Define scope and structure, then configure target behaviour to match your organisation’s needs.

Meta-model structure for platform setup A platform meta-model defines the components and attributes available to solutions.

Models

Visual interface modelling pages and components Visual layouts translate business needs into application screens, entities, APIs, and workflows.

A visual representation of your requirements. Models are the source for generation — entity, security, API, requirements, UI, and workflows. Configure the target application in the model and in source for fine-grained control.

Pipelines

Automation that turns models into working software. Pipelines integrate with modern practices like Git and CI/CD to export, generate, test, and deploy reliably.

Pipeline view linking models to automated generation and deployment Export & commit steps connect models to your repositories and delivery pipelines.

Learn about our process and solutions

Process Process    Capability statement Capability statement

Join our monthly newsletter & we’ll
plant a tree.

We are planting one tree through Carbon Positive Australia in exchange for your contact details.

Verify You’re HumanPlease type the characters shown below.

Made with ❤️ in Milton, Brisbane (Meanjin) Australia.

WorkingMouse acknowledges the Traditional Owners and their continuing connection to land, sea and community. We pay our respects to them, their Elders, both past and emerging.

Torres Strait Islands Flag Australian Flag Aboriginal Flag
Top B2B Companies Clutch Award 2022 Clutch Top Company 2022 2023 Clutch Award 2018 iAwards 2023 Buy Queensland Finalist Award Award 1 Technology Fast 50 2017


2025 WorkingMouse Pty Ltd. All Rights Reserved.